      Abstract
      The Village Fund is a right owned by the village. Law No. 6 of 2014 on Villages explains that village finances sl.rould be managed with due regard to accountable, transparent, participatory, and implemented principles ruith discipline and budgetary discipline. Based on accountability, the viliage government has an obligation to manage the Village Fund and to account for it. The Village Fund is one ofthem devoted to the development ofinfrastructure whose output can benefit the welfare of rural communities. This study aims to analyze the accountability of village fund management for infrastructure development located in Tegalrejo Village, Gedangsari District, Gunungkidul Regency. This study uses a qualitative method. Data collection techniques used are interviews and documentation sourced from village government, community, and BPD. The finding in this research is that accountability of viilage fund management for Tegalreio Village infrastructure development is poor. This is caused by several problems that consist of: no details of time related to the time of implementation of infrastructure development program; Iess transparent in delivering budget management reports in infrastructure development; not all communities have been actively participating in the implementation of infrastructure development; has not been maxinlized in the utilization of Village Information System (SID) in the form of website as a means to inform Village Fund management report for infrastructure development; and village apparatus that lack coordination with the community related to the irnplemerrtation of infrastructure development,
